Output f3c47bad0e8d26feb36f8ddf00de4c56a9e59ac4bf44d1c067eed76b52239cde:17

value
2958582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8fcc7b78b6887c32d33a2a6134f6766faaca8bc OP_EQUAL
address
3JZ95K6pwQ9WrNTP72swk6HtDswmxePqdF
transaction
f3c47bad0e8d26feb36f8ddf00de4c56a9e59ac4bf44d1c067eed76b52239cde
confirmations
390274
spent
true